Obesity And The Activity Of The Autonomicnervous System, Rami̇s Çolak, Emi̇r Dönder, Azi̇z Karaoğlu, Oğuz Ayhan, Mehmet Yalniz Jan 2000

Obesity And The Activity Of The Autonomicnervous System, Rami̇s Çolak, Emi̇r Dönder, Azi̇z Karaoğlu, Oğuz Ayhan, Mehmet Yalniz

Turkish Journal of Medical Sciences

This study was conducted to examine the autonomic nervous system functions of obese people. The study group consisted of 30 healthy obese people (20 female, 10 male, age range 18-58, median 37.6±9.7 years of age) and the control group consisted of 30 healthy nonobese people (18 female, 12 male, age range 17- 56, median 34.4±7.5 years). Each function was tested by non-invasive applications (orthostatic test, isometric exercise test, Valsalva ratio test, 30/15 ratio test, heart rate change test by deep respiration).
